DokuWiki Training Class Outline - Wiki 101

This class is designed for attendees with minimal technical experience who want to learn how to create and manage their own wiki using DokuWiki.

1. Introduction to DokuWiki

  • What is DokuWiki
  • Key features and benefits
  • How wikis are used (personal, business, community)

2. Installing and Accessing DokuWiki

  • Options for using DokuWiki:
    • Hosting it yourself
    • Using a hosted service
  • Basic navigation overview

3. Understanding DokuWiki Structure

  • Namespaces
  • Pages
  • Hierarchies and organization

4. Creating and Editing Pages

  • Adding new pages
  • Editing existing pages
  • Using the built-in editor

5. Basic Formatting

  • Headings
  • Lists
  • Bold, italic, underline
  • Links (internal and external)
  • Images

6. Advanced Page Features

  • Tables
  • Code blocks
  • Footnotes
  • Plugins overview

7. Managing Files and Media

  • Uploading images and documents
  • Organizing media files

8. Using Plugins and Templates

  • What plugins are
  • How to install and manage plugins
  • Template basics for wiki customization

9. User Management and Access Control

  • Adding and managing users
  • Setting permissions
  • Creating user groups

10. Best Practices for Organizing a Wiki

  • Consistent naming conventions
  • Structuring information logically
  • Encouraging collaboration

11. Hands-On Practice

  • Creating a sample page
  • Adding media
  • Formatting content
  • Linking pages

12. Resources and Next Steps

  • Official DokuWiki documentation
  • Community forums
  • Tutorials and video guides
